Health First Colorado (Colorado’s Medicaid program) members have the option to get prescription medications through the mail. New or refill prescriptions for chronic conditions may be written for as much as a 100-day supply. Please note that Health First Colorado does not pay for nor reimburse pharmacies for delivery fees. The Colorado Medical Assistance Estate Recovery Program is a federally mandated program that requires the State of Colorado to recover Health First Colorado expenditures correctly paid on behalf of certain Health First Colorado members. After the death of a person who has received medical assistance, the law requires that certain individual's ... Dec 7, 2022 ... Or go to your local WIC ofice or to.Health First Colorado is public health insurance (Medicaid) for Coloradans who qualify. Medicaid is funded jointly by the federal government and Colorado state government, and is administered by the Department of Health Care Policy & Financing. Each state manages its own Medicaid program differently.Health First Colorado is Colorado's Medicaid program. Coloradans can apply for Health First Colorado and Child Health Plan Plus any time of the year. Unlike employer-sponsored coverage or the Connect for Health Colorado marketplace exchange, there is no “enrollment period.”. Apply online any hour of the day, upload needed documents with your application, and track the status of your application. Telemedicine helps connect Health First Colorado (Colorado's Medicaid Program) members to health care providers through live video. It can help you get the care and consultation you need without traveling to visit a provider in another city or area of the state. You can use telemedicine for routine medical care, therapy appointments, speech ... However, the state’s arid climate can wreak havoc on your hair color. The...Home and Community Based Services (HCBS) Waivers. A waiver is an extra set of Health First Colorado (Colorado's Medicaid program) benefits that you could qualify for in certain cases. These benefits can help you remain in your home and community.
